The Challenge

The Client envisioned a monitoring system that allows to add all of your properties to the unified system and track new complaints, DOB Violations, ECB Violations and Hearings, Permit expiration notices, and job status changes with a single click. Once the Client specified the requirements, we felt we couldn’t miss the opportunity to bring this idea to life. 

Despite the smooth start, our team soon faced unpredictable access issues, with random bans throwing a wrench into the works. The precise reasons for these restrictions remained unclear, with hypotheses ranging from changes in the site’s policies to the site’s detection mechanisms identifying the traffic as suspicious, possibly due to geographical origin.

To address this issue, our team had to think on their feet, implementing creative server management strategies under the tight constraints of limited time and budget.

Eventually, a late-stage requirement emerged, transforming the system’s architecture from supporting single ownership of properties to enabling multiple owners. This step aimed to democratise system access but required considerable last-minute architectural overhauls, challenging our team to adapt quickly to meet the expanded needs of a diverse user base.

The Solution

Altamira team developed the MVP of a Highrise Monitoring System – a complex web application tailored specifically to the Client’s needs. This powerful platform employs advanced approaches to data management, like data parsing and scraping, to monitor public boards for building violations from various state registers.

The system aims to address all inconveniences of manual monitoring in the registers because

Our system allows every property owner to create a list of their properties and view general information and statistics on them. It offers a suite of features to streamline violation management:

  • Real-Time Notifications: The system promptly informs users about new property issues, enabling them to act swiftly and prevent complaints from escalating into violations.
  • 24/7 Access to Property Details: Users can track the status of each property around the clock via both smartphones and computers.
  • Hearing Dates and Reminders: Users can potentially view upcoming hearing dates and receive timely reminders, ensuring they never miss a critical deadline.
  • Technology Stack: The system is built using advanced parsing and scraping technologies, along with Stripe, for secure transactions.
  • Development: A total of 2265 hours were dedicated to developing the MVP, ensuring robust functionality and user-friendliness.

Design

The design objective was to create a user-centric interface that enables property owners to efficiently manage their property listings. The design needed to be intuitive, allowing users to add, view, and search properties with ease.

Process

We began with a discovery phase, where we conducted user research to understand the needs of property owners. This informed our design decisions and helped us prioritise features for the MVP. We created wireframes and prototypes, which were iterated based on feedback from potential users.

User interface

The user interface is clean and minimalistic, adhering to modern design principles. It uses a neutral colour palette with accent colours for call-to-action buttons, ensuring high visibility and accessibility. The “My Properties” section is the heart of the application, listing properties in a clear, tabulated format that allows for quick scanning of key information.

Navigation

Navigation is simple, with a top bar for application-wide options and a side menu for specific property-related actions.

Responsiveness

The application is designed to be responsive, ensuring that property managers can access their portfolios on various devices, including desktops, tablets, and smartphones. This adaptability ensures functionality across different contexts, from office environments to on-site property visits.
